Subject: Quickstore 4.2 — bloom filter now fronts the KV layer

Plugin authors: starting with this release, Quickstore places a bloom filter ahead of the key-value store. Negative lookups return faster; false positives fall through safely. No API changes are required on your side. Verify your plugin against the staging build referenced below.

session token of fahif-tadup = htk3_9c7

Subject: the new Lumen Plus subscription tier at Fennick Media. Launch window: early next quarter. Pricing sits 30% above the base tier; bundles the Archive Vault and priority rendering. Beta cohort in Old Carraway showed 18% uptake, churn unchanged. Support load manageable with current headcount. Marketing spend capped until conversion data matures. Heads of department should align roadmaps accordingly. Risks: cannibalisation of annual plans; mitigation under review. The confidential plan summary appears below.

internal memo for kahap-hahig: Only 7 of the 120 pilot accounts renewed Zorix, so a churn review is set for January 15.

# Schema migrations on Verdantide run zero-downtime: expand, backfill, contract.
# Never ship a contract phase in the same release as its expand phase.
# This client talks to the internal Migrant service, which tracks phase state
# and blocks deploys mid-backfill. Release manager must confirm phase status
# before cutting a tag. Client auth uses the Migrant staging key, set below.

service key, fawip-bajef: kto11_Qt5wZK9vdNC